A comprehensive guide for researchers conducting advanced data analysis and reporting for top marketing journals. It details selecting the appropriate econometric estimator (e.g., ANOVA, DiD, IV, mediation models) based on the study design (experimental, observational, panel). It emphasizes meeting rigorous journal mandates, including exact p-values, standard errors, and effect sizes, and linking statistical findings to practical managerial claims.
